Intermittent Fever: Together With The Repertory Of Carl Von Boenninghausen is a book written by Phineas Parkhurst Wells in 1891. The book provides a comprehensive guide to treating intermittent fever, a common illness at the time, using the principles of homeopathy. Wells explains the symptoms and causes of the fever and offers a range of remedies that can be used to treat it. The book also includes a repertory, or a reference guide, compiled by Carl Von Boenninghausen, which lists various symptoms and their corresponding remedies. This repertory is a valuable tool for homeopathic practitioners and students alike.
